Crafting Music Like Jeff Bhasker: A Guide for Aspiring Music Creators

stayc main image

Jeff Bhasker is a legendary figure in the music industry, celebrated for his outstanding contributions as a producer, songwriter, and multi-instrumentalist. His Grammy-winning career has seen collaborations with icons like Kanye West, Bruno Mars, and Taylor Swift, each project showcasing his unique blend of innovation and musical mastery. If you're a music creator looking to emulate Bhasker's style, this guide is tailored for you. Let's dive into the key elements that define Jeff Bhasker's sound and how you can incorporate them into your own music production journey.

1. Understand the Bhasker Signature Sound

Jeff Bhasker's music is an eclectic mix of pop, rock, R&B, and hip-hop, characterized by lush arrangements, powerful melodies, and innovative production techniques. Here’s how to capture his essence:

  • Melodic Excellence: Bhasker’s melodies are memorable and emotionally charged. Focus on creating strong melodic lines that can carry the weight of the song.
  • Harmonic Richness: Use complex chord progressions and rich harmonies to add depth to your tracks. Bhasker often incorporates jazz and classical influences to achieve this.
  • Dynamic Arrangements: Pay attention to the arrangement of your tracks. Bhasker's productions often feature dynamic shifts and intricate layering of instruments and vocals.

2. Instrumental Mastery

Bhasker’s proficiency with multiple instruments sets him apart. To emulate his instrumental prowess:

  • Learn Multiple Instruments: Diversify your instrumental skills. Start with keyboards and guitar, as these are central to Bhasker’s productions.
  • Experiment with Synthesizers: Bhasker uses a wide range of synthesizers to create unique sounds. Experiment with different synths and sound design techniques to develop your own signature tones.
  • Incorporate Live Instruments: While electronic elements are prominent, Bhasker’s tracks often feature live instrumentation. Incorporate live drums, brass, or string sections to add a human touch to your music.

3. Collaborative Spirit

Collaboration is a cornerstone of Bhasker’s success. He often works with other producers, songwriters, and artists to bring his musical visions to life. Here’s how to adopt a collaborative approach:

  • Network with Other Musicians: Build a network of talented musicians, producers, and songwriters. Collaborate on projects to expand your creative horizons.
  • Be Open to Ideas: Embrace the ideas and suggestions of your collaborators. Bhasker’s willingness to experiment and adapt is a key factor in his success.
  • Co-Write Songs: Co-writing can bring fresh perspectives to your music. Partner with lyricists and other composers to craft compelling lyrics and compositions.

4. Production Techniques

Bhasker’s production style is innovative and meticulous. Here are some production techniques to help you emulate his sound:

  • Layering: Bhasker’s tracks are known for their intricate layering of sounds. Use multiple layers of instruments and vocals to create a rich, textured soundscape.
  • Vocal Production: Pay special attention to vocal production. Bhasker often uses harmonies, doubles, and vocal effects to enhance the vocal performance.
  • Mixing and Mastering: A polished mix is essential. Invest time in learning mixing and mastering techniques or collaborate with a skilled engineer to ensure your tracks sound professional.

5. Musical Influences and Inspirations

Bhasker draws inspiration from a wide range of musical genres and artists. To develop a similar breadth of influence:

  • Listen to Diverse Genres: Expand your musical palette by exploring different genres, from classical to hip-hop. Analyze what makes each genre unique and incorporate those elements into your music.
  • Study Bhasker’s Work: Listen to Bhasker’s discography and analyze his productions. Identify common themes, techniques, and stylistic choices that you can adapt to your own work.

6. Creative Mindset

Adopting a creative mindset is crucial. Bhasker’s willingness to push boundaries and experiment is a cornerstone of his success. Here’s how to cultivate a creative mindset:

  • Stay Curious: Always be on the lookout for new sounds, techniques, and ideas. Curiosity drives innovation.
  • Take Risks: Don’t be afraid to take creative risks. Experiment with unconventional ideas and sounds to discover something unique.
  • Keep Learning: The music industry is constantly evolving. Stay updated with the latest trends, tools, and technologies to keep your productions fresh and relevant.

Practical Tips for Your Music Journey
